Bachelor of Arts in Multimedia is a 3-year undergraduate degree focused on the discipline of multimedia and further diversifying into subfields like animation, script writing, producing, and visual gaming expertise. Students are also exposed to current media technologies, communication theories, and 3D concepts. In this course, you will also learn about 3D concepts, digital photography, and graphic design.

The curriculum is focused on different topics such as social media, mass communication, music, and art history. A BA in Multimedia eligibility demands an intermediate degree along with qualifying entrance tests from different colleges and universities to guarantee a successful admission into this course program. The average cost of this course varies from INR 40,000 to 1 lakhs and the degree can be achieved after three years of course completion.

Graduates with this degree will find many exciting career opportunities in the media industry. Students can pursue various career options with the degree of Multimedia owing to its popularity and subdisciplines' diversity like Video, line, or audio producer, Computer software designer, and Web designer, Graphic designer, Video game designer, Animator or motion graphics designer. They can also opt for creative writing and can pursue script and theater writing on a professional basis.

BA Multimedia Course Details

The BA in Multimedia is a three-year course that involves communication, design, and technology. The program focuses on training students with specific media skills in particular that relate to animation, video, graphic design, web development, and digital storytelling. Students learn to create visual content using today's modern software tools, audio-visual communication, media ethics, and digital marketing. The program seeks to stimulate creative thinking in students while providing practical experience through the use of relevant industry media tools. Career prospects include animation, advertising, film production, graphic design, web development, and UI/UX design.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Course Details:

Feature Description
Full Course Name Bachelor of Arts in Multimedia
Course Level Undergraduate
Duration 3 Years (6 Semesters)
Field or Stream Arts, Media, Design, Communication, Visual Arts
Course Objective To equip students with creative and technical skills in multimedia including animation, graphic design, video production, sound design, web development, and digital media.
Core Subjects Multimedia Technologies, Fundamentals of Design, 2D Animation, 3D Animation, Web Design, Graphic Design, Digital Video Production, Visual Effects (VFX), Audio Editing, Communication Skills
Elective Subjects Motion Graphics, Game Design, Photography, Augmented and Virtual Reality Fundamentals, Script Writing, Branding and Advertising
Practical Components Animation Labs, Video Editing Projects, Portfolio Development, Internship or Industry Training, Capstone Project
Skills Taught Design Thinking, Storyboarding, Software Proficiency, Creative Communication, Time Management, Project Management
Software and Tools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, Adobe Premiere Pro, Adobe After Effects, Autodesk Maya, Blender, Final Cut Pro, CorelDRAW, Adobe Flash
Assessment Methods Semester Exams, Project Submissions, Viva, Practical Exams, Portfolio Review
Career Options Animator, VFX Artist, Web Designer, UI Designer, UX Designer, Graphic Designer, Game Designer, Content Creator, Video Editor, Multimedia Specialist
Industries and Employers Animation Studios, Game Development Studios, Advertising Agencies, Film Production Houses, Television Channels, IT Companies, Design Agencies
Salary Range INR 2.5 to INR 6 LPA (entry level), INR 6 to INR 12 LPA (mid-level), INR 15 LPA and above (senior level with experience)

BA Multimedia Eligibility Criteria 2026

BA in Multimedia eligibility criteria require to have completed a 10+2 education from a recognized board. Candidates from all streams are typically accepted into most institutions. Though it recommended that candidates should have a strong interest in media, design or digital communication, would be expected. Some colleges may have a minimum aggregate percentage of 50%, some colleges may even interview or review portfolios to assess the candidate's eligibility. Some skills and competencies beyond 10+2 will help candidates to be eligible for admission . Basic computer skills and creativity in visual, media or art education can help candidates gain a competitive advantage.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Eligibility Criteria 2026:

Criteria Type Details
Educational Qualification 10+2 (Higher Secondary) from a recognized board in any stream including Arts, Science, or Commerce
Minimum Marks Required Typically 45% to 50% aggregate in Class 12, may vary slightly based on college or university policies
Age Limit Generally 17 years and above, though most colleges do not enforce a strict upper age limit
Stream Flexibility Open to students from all academic backgrounds including Arts, Science, and Commerce
Portfolio Requirement Optional in most colleges, but some design-focused institutions may request a portfolio showcasing creativity or previous multimedia work
Additional Preferences Some colleges prefer candidates with basic computer knowledge, communication skills, and a demonstrated interest in creative or media-related fields

BA Multimedia Admission Process 2026

The BA in Multimedia admission process differs from institution to institution, however they are ultimately likely to have a shared process within admission procedures. Most colleges generally offer merit-based admission, consistent with 10+2 marks of the applicant. Similarly, some universities or other reputed institutions may have entrance exams, interview rounds, or portfolio submissions. After students submit an application for either online or offline channels, shortlisted students are selected according to eligibility. Shortlisted candidates are to call for counseling, or other interview rounds. It is important to be aware of deadlines for admissions, applicable documents to be submitted, and fees to be submitted.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Admission Process 2026:

Stage Details
Application Mode Online or offline application through the official website or campus admission office
Merit-Based Admission Based on Class 12 marks or academic performance without entrance test in many public and private institutions
Entrance Test Admission Some colleges conduct their own entrance exams to assess aptitude in design, creativity, and general awareness
Interview or Skill Test Certain institutes may include a personal interview, group discussion, or skill-based test (like drawing or software demo) as part of the selection process
Portfolio Submission Optional but encouraged by some institutions for candidates applying under creative categories
Document Verification Submission of academic certificates, identity proof, photographs, and migration certificate at the time of admission
Final Admission Offer Based on aggregate score from entrance, interview, academic performance, and availability of seats

BA Multimedia Entrance Exam 2026

Some colleges conduct admissions based on the marks of a 10+2 pass while a few top institutions go for entrance exams for BA Multimedia programs. These entrance exams test the aptitude of candidates in general awareness, creativity, media familiarity, and basic design skills. BA Multimedia entrance exams include CUET, NID DAT, and various college-level entrance tests. Some universities also conduct interviews as part of the selection process. Preparing a creative portfolio of artwork, photographs, or design projects would make a strong application.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Entrance Exam 2026:

Exam Name Conducting Body Colleges Covered Mode of Exam Subjects Tested Frequency
CUET (UG) National Testing Agency (NTA) Central and some private universities Online English Language, General Test, Domain Subjects Once a year
NID DAT National Institute of Design NID Campuses (Design-oriented programs) Offline Design Aptitude, Creativity, Observation Skills Once a year
UCEED IIT Bombay IITs and design institutions Online Visualization, Analytical Reasoning, Design Thinking Once a year
AIMA UGAT All India Management Association Participating private universities and colleges Online or Offline English Language, Reasoning, Numerical Ability Once a year
Institute-Level Tests Individual institutions Amity University, Pearl Academy, Chandigarh University, etc. Varies Creative Aptitude, Drawing, Interview Varies by institute

Types of BA Multimedia

There are several different types of BA Multimedia programs that can accommodate the needs of students. Regular full-time courses include in-classroom learning and hands-on learning, as well as workshops providing the best opportunity for learning. Distance education programs have students studying completely apart from their teachers and classmates and no interaction with other students and teachers. For students that are also working or engaged in other learning contexts, there are part-time courses that take class evenings or weekends. Finally, there are online BA Multimedia courses, which include all learning as video lectures, assignments, and labs conducted online, allowing a learner to study wherever they choose.

Here are the key details about the types of BA Multimedia:

Type Mode of Study Duration Key Features Target Audience Institutions Offering
Regular Full-time, On-campus 3 Years Includes classroom lectures, practical labs, group projects, internships, and real-time interaction School graduates, students seeking full college experience DU, JNU, Calicut University, Amity University, LPU
Distance Education Self-paced, Remote 3 to 6 Years Study material delivered via post or online, limited face-to-face sessions, flexible scheduling Working professionals, rural or remote learners IGNOU, Annamalai University, Tamil Nadu Open University
Part-Time Evening or Weekend Classes 3 to 5 Years Classes on weekends or evenings, allows study alongside job or other commitments Working adults, career switchers, professionals Few private design institutes, state open universities
Online Fully Online 3 Years (flexible) Learning via digital platforms, pre-recorded video lessons, online support and assessments Learners needing remote access or international students Arena Animation Online, AAFT Online, Coursera + university
Integrated Full-time, On-campus 5 Years (UG + PG) Combines Bachelor's and Master's degrees in Multimedia with industry exposure and internships Students seeking long-term specialization and academic depth SRM University, Sharda University, Jain University

BA Multimedia Syllabus 2026

The BA in Multimedia syllabus offer both theoretical and practical elements in the areas of media, design and communication. Typical core subjects include introduction to multimedia, graphic design, the design of websites, animation principles, multimedia video editing, digital photography, communication theory, history and practice of audio-visual communication, and programming in multimedia. The topics of visual culture, media ethics, communication skills, and digital marketing may also appear in the syllabus. Many programs have an extensive amount of learning-by-doing and include internships or workshops situated in an authentic industry setting.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Syllabus 2026:

Year 1:

Semester Subjects Covered
Semester 1 Introduction to Multimedia, Basics of Design and Visual Arts, Fundamentals of Computer Graphics, Communication Skills, Introduction to Digital Photography, Language (English or Regional)
Semester 2 Multimedia Systems, Drawing and Illustration, HTML and Web Design Basics, Principles of Animation, Audio and Video Editing Basics, Environmental Studies

Year 2:

Semester Subjects Covered
Semester 3 2D Animation, Script Writing for Media, Visual Communication, Adobe Photoshop and Illustrator, Digital Storyboarding, Elective I (e.g., Media Laws or Journalism Basics)
Semester 4 3D Animation and Modeling, Advanced Web Design, Typography and Layout Design, Sound Design and Mixing, Media Ethics and Cyber Laws, Elective II (e.g., Digital Marketing or Photography Techniques)

Year 3:

Semester Subjects Covered
Semester 5 Motion Graphics and Compositing, UI/UX Design Principles, Visual Effects (VFX), Portfolio Development, Pre-Production and Planning, Project Work (Part I)
Semester 6 Advanced Animation Techniques, Game Design and Development Basics, Media Project Management, Internship/Industry Training, Project Work (Part II), Viva Voce or Final Presentation

BA Multimedia Skills Required

In a BA multimedia career, there is a mix of skills you will develop that encompass both creative and technical skills. You need to know how to use design software like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ator and Corel Draw, Adobe Premiere Pro, After Effects and iMovie, and Final Cut Pro and Audacity. Having knowledge in coding (using HTML, CSS, familiarity with digital tools) will also help with employability. Communicating with classmates in team situations or when presenting to clients will require strong written and verbal communication skills. It is also important to have problem-solving skills, strong time management skills, flexible attitude and willingness to adopt new technologies.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Skills Required:

Skill Category Description
Creativity and Imagination Ability to visualize and create unique multimedia concepts for digital content, animations, and graphics
Graphic Design Skills Proficiency in software like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, CorelDRAW for designing visual elements
Video and Audio Editing Knowledge of editing tools like Premiere Pro, After Effects, Final Cut Pro, Audacity, etc.
Animation and Motion Graphics Understanding principles of 2D/3D animation, character rigging, and motion design
Web Designing HTML, CSS, JavaScript basics, and UI/UX design fundamentals
Storyboarding and Scriptwriting Ability to conceptualize scenes, write scripts, and develop media content frameworks
Communication Skills Effective verbal and written communication for working in creative teams and client discussions
Time Management Managing deadlines in a project-driven, time-bound creative workflow
Attention to Detail Precision in editing, color correction, typography, and animations
Team Collaboration Working efficiently with designers, coders, sound artists, and clients in production pipelines

BA Multimedia Fee Structure 2026

BA Multimedia fee structure in India are very different between public and private colleges. In the major private colleges such as Creative Multimedia College of Fine Arts, the entire cost of the course will be between INR 5 to INR 6 lakhs, depending on specializations and college facilities. The cost is significantly lower at government colleges such as Indraprastha College for Women in Delhi University or Government Arts College, which will offer a similar degree for under INR 1 lakh cost on a normal basis. In addition, many institutions will offer scholarship and financial assistance schemes to help deserving students.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Fee Structure 2026:

Type of Institution Fee Range (Per Year) Total Course Fee (Approx.) Remarks
Government Colleges INR 5,000 – INR 30,000 INR 15,000 – INR 90,000 Highly affordable, limited seats, fewer tech upgrades
Private Colleges (Tier 2) INR 50,000 – INR 1.2 lakh INR 1.5 lakh – INR 3.6 lakh Good facilities, industry projects included
Private Colleges (Tier 1) INR 1.2 lakh – INR 2.5 lakh INR 3.6 lakh – INR 7.5 lakh State-of-the-art labs, international exposure
Distance Learning INR 10,000 – INR 40,000 INR 30,000 – INR 1.2 lakh Flexible but limited hands-on experience
Online Platforms (UGC-approved) INR 20,000 – INR 60,000 INR 60,000 – INR 1.8 lakh Self-paced, skill-focused, certificate-heavy

BA Multimedia Career Opportunities

A BA in Multimedia program prepares you for a variety of career opportunities in the digital world. The BA in Multimedia job opportunities are graphic designer, web designer, animator, video editor, UI/UX designer, multimedia content developer, or digital marketing specialist. There are positions available in advertising, television, film, gaming, e-learning, and even in digital publishing, as places are always looking for multimedia creators. Some graduates may also find work in corporate communications, event management, or public relations.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Career Opportunities:

Career Path Job Description Industries Growth Potential
Graphic Designer Designs visual content for branding, advertising, web, and print media Advertising, IT, Media High with creative portfolio and tools mastery
2D/3D Animator Creates animated characters, objects, and environments using specialized software Animation, Gaming, Films Very high with experience and showreel
Video Editor Cuts and assembles raw footage into polished videos for TV, YouTube, and film Media Houses, Freelance High with storytelling and editing software skills
UI/UX Designer Designs user-friendly and visually appealing interfaces for apps and websites Tech, Product Companies Strong growth with coding knowledge
Web Designer/Developer Develops and designs websites with focus on aesthetics and functionality IT, Freelance, Startups Grows with front-end/back-end expertise
VFX Artist Adds realistic effects and computer-generated imagery to film or video Film Studios, OTT, Gaming High in film/gaming industries
Multimedia Specialist Combines text, audio, graphics, and video into integrated digital presentations Education, Corporate Moderate, depending on sector
Digital Content Creator Creates content for YouTube, Instagram, blogs, and e-learning platforms Media, EdTech, Freelance Very high (self-employed or influencer career)
Art Director Oversees visual direction for advertising campaigns or film projects Advertising, Films Senior-level, post 5–7 years experience
Game Designer Designs characters, storylines, levels, and gameplay elements Gaming, AR/VR Excellent in global market with Unity/Unreal skills
Motion Graphics Designer Creates animated visual elements for videos, presentations, or TV Media, Corporates Great demand in ad and OTT spaces

BA Multimedia Salary in India

The BA Multimedia salary is based on their position, experience, and the organization that employs them. The starting salaries for various roles, such as graphic designer, video editor, or content creator, usually fall within the range of INR 2.5 to INR 4 lakh per year. These roles can offer a bit more income due to equity and the importance of people's internet sites or app designing skills. With experience, salaries can increase to a range of INR 6 to INR 10 lakh per year or more, especially for positions such as multimedia producers or creative directors. Organizations such as Amazon, MPC, Wipro, and other advertising agencies domicile multimedia graduates as their information is completed for organization that are creating creative and digital based placements.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Salary in India:

Job Role Entry-Level Salary (0–2 years) Mid-Level (3–5 years) Senior Level (5+ years) Remarks
Graphic Designer INR 2.0 – INR 4.0 LPA INR 5.0 – INR 7.5 LPA INR 8.0 – INR 12 LPA Better with Adobe Suite, Figma skills
Animator (2D/3D) INR 2.5 – INR 5.0 LPA INR 6.0 – INR 9.0 LPA INR 10 – INR 15 LPA Portfolios essential
Video Editor INR 2.0 – INR 4.0 LPA INR 5.0 – INR 8.0 LPA INR 10 – INR 14 LPA High demand in OTT and YouTube channels
UI/UX Designer INR 3.5 – INR 6.5 LPA INR 7.0 – INR 12 LPA INR 14 – INR 20+ LPA Strong growth with coding/design combo
Web Designer/Developer INR 2.5 – INR 5.0 LPA INR 6.0 – INR 10 LPA INR 12 – INR 18 LPA Strong with HTML/CSS/JavaScript/React
VFX Artist INR 2.0 – INR 4.5 LPA INR 5.5 – INR 9.0 LPA INR 10 – INR 16 LPA Studios pay based on project budget
Multimedia Specialist INR 2.0 – INR 3.5 LPA INR 4.5 – INR 6.5 LPA INR 7.0 – INR 10 LPA Corporate/EdTech have stable roles
Content Creator (Freelance) INR 1.5 – INR 5.0 LPA INR 6.0 – INR 10+ LPA INR 12+ LPA / sponsorships Depends on platform growth and following
Game Designer INR 3.0 – INR 6.0 LPA INR 7.0 – INR 12 LPA INR 14 – INR 20+ LPA Unity, Unreal Engine experience critical

BA Multimedia Scholarships

Colleges provide scholarships to deserving students in the BA in Multimedia program. Scholarships are usually based on merit, need, or category-specific. Under Delhi University, colleges such as Indraprastha College for Women offer merit-cum-means scholarships and fee concession for eligible students. Some private colleges provide institutional scholarships for outstanding achievers or for students who face financial constraints or hardship. In addition, central and state government agencies provide scholarships through National Scholarship Portal - NSP, Post-Matric Scholarships, and E-Kalyan for students in reserved categories. Students must apply early and keep a good record to have the best chance of finding financial support.

Here are the key details about the BA Multimedia Scholarships:

Scholarship Name Eligibility Criteria Award Amount Provider
National Scholarship Portal (NSP) Based on merit/income (under INR 8L), minority categories INR 10,000 – INR 50,000 per year Govt. of India
Post Matric Scholarships For SC/ST/OBC/EWS students in recognized colleges INR 5,000 – INR 30,000 State Governments
Adobe Creativity Scholarship High-achieving creative students, portfolio required Tuition + expenses Adobe Foundation
NSDL Shiksha Sahyog Family income under INR 3L, academic performance INR 10,000 – INR 30,000 NSDL Foundation
HDFC Parivartan ECS Scholarship Low-income families (INR 2.5L max), UG students INR 15,000 – INR 75,000 HDFC Bank
Tata Trusts Scholarship Financial need + merit for arts/media students INR 10,000 – INR 1 lakh Tata Trusts
Sitaram Jindal Foundation Scholarship UG arts stream, < INR 4L income, min 60% marks INR 500 – INR 2,000/month SJF India
Private/Institutional Scholarships College-based merit & talent awards 25% – 100% fee waiver Christ, Amity, Pearl, etc.
